Association Agreement with the EU: new round of negotiations between San Marino and the European Commission. Three members of the Government also participated remotely, by videoconference. The Secretary of State for Foreign Affairs Beccari – who is the chief negotiator for San Marino – the Secretary of State Catsinvolved on financial services and the Secretary of State Lonfernini, which analyzed the issue of people’s mobility for work reasons. Employment policies are also on the table, after the recent reform, with an in-depth look at secondments, temporary workers and fixed-term contracts. Three aspects that will be regulated with a decree by June.
In view of the possible finalization of the Association Agreement with the European Union within the year, the production of San Marino legislation, not only on work, must be in harmony with the EU directives. On the agenda of today’s meeting with the delegation of the EU Commission also the energy file and the question of state aid.
“We have progressed on some points – declares Foreign Secretary Beccari – but of course there is still work to be done many insights, even if the picture is getting clearer”. A new round of negotiations with Brussels is already expected in early March.
